Okay binoculars, Soft and camera are a joke.
by olivierdupondt ,Aug 01 '07
Pros: It makes a good rattle for my 14 month old son. The binoculars are average.
Cons: soft usability-quality-bug testing-standard, customer support, communication with the company, horrible camera.
Binocular are okay. But they really f..ed it up with the camera and soft. Bushnell should stay away from this business until they get a basic understanding of how it works:

- Driver faulty, no fix downloadable from their website, no customer support, (come on guys this is BASIC)
- There is some weird middleware application to download the pictures... got it to work after one hour and 3 crashes. It does not even meet Microsoft Windows development guidelines. The only way to close it is to reboot you computer or use alt-cont-del and end the process.
- Some marketing genius made some partnership with Roxio to include their soft on the CD. Roxio is one of the worst picture manager on the market. There are much better free ones out there (ie Picasa...)

Overall, an amateurish product, lack of customer support AND no easy way to communicate with the company (you can't even send them e-mails)... I can understand when a company tries to diversify, they can make mistakes, but they should at least learn from those... what infuriates me is that they do not even bother listening to their customers. Why partnerships are important in new products.
by kablewey ,Dec 22 '03
Pros: neat idea
Cons: bad software driver doesn't work
This is obvious. A pretty good binocular company makes a bad partnership with a digital camera company and maybe a software company. The result: pretty good binoculars, mediocre camera (though the specs ARE clearly stated) and really CRAPPY SOFTWARE DRIVER!

I've had this thing for 2 months now and still have not had luck getting the pictures from it. The problem seems to be Windows XP.

By the way when they tell you to go ahead and install the XP driver even though Microsoft says it isn't tested don't do it! If you still want to do it then set a system backup point first then install. This driver blue screened my high quality laptop every time I tried installing it. However, my crappy desktop doesn't crash but doesn't work with the camera either.

I have tried calling Jeff West too like the other reviews stated but he is a hard guy to get a hold of.

Hopefully one of the camera companies will produce a binoculars. At least lenses don't need drivers.

My focus works OK, is not sticky like the other review said.

Not bad For What I Paid
by gjwags1 ,Dec 30 '03
Pros: Great idea; convenience; inexpensive.
Cons: No lens caps; cumbersome software; poor quality of pictures without bright sunlight.
I saw this in the local sporting goods store and thought, what a great idea! Since it was priced cheaply (between $50-$60) I thought I'd give it a try. However looking at the price of comparable binoculars, and knowing the price of a good digital camera, common sense told me not to expect top quality photos. I had no problem installing and using the software, maybe because I'm behind the times and still use the Windows 98 operating system. The software is similar to what came with my inexpensive web cam/camera, so I was familiar with it and how it worked. Since the software is cumbersome, I use it only to download the pictures, and then switch to a different editing program once the pictures are on my computer. The pictures aren't anything I'd want to frame, but they are sufficient for what I intend to use it for. Like my web cam/camera, it does quite fair in bright sunlight, but only so-so with thick clouds. And I might even recommend it to someone, of course depending what they wanted to use it for, because after all, you get what you pay for!
